PROTAC linker
N-(m-PEG4)-N'-(m-PEG4)-O-(m-PEG4)-O'-(azide-PEG4)-Cy5 functions as a PEG-based PROTAC linker, facilitating the synthesis of proteolysis-targeting chimeras (PROTACs). This compound is equipped with an azide group, enabling it to participate in copper-catalyzed azide-alkyne cycloaddition reactions (CuAAc) with alkyne-containing molecules. Additionally, it supports strain-promoted alkyne-azide cycloaddition (SPAAC) reactions with DBCO or BCN groups, making it a versatile tool for chemical biology applications in targeted protein degradation research.

Product Information
Catalog NumA83770
FormulaC62H100ClN5O18
Molecular Weight1238.93
CAS Number2107273-58-3
SMILESCOCCOCCOCCOCCOC1=CC2=C([N+](CCOCCOCCOCCOC)=C(/C=C/C=C/C=C3N(CCOCCOCCOCCOC)C4=C(C=C(OCCOCCOCCOCCOCCN=[N+]=[N-])C=C4)C/3(C)C)C2(C)C)C=C1.[Cl-]
